When Does Mold Become A Problem?

Mold spores are found in almost every room, with an average of 200 to 700 spores per room. In small amounts, these spores are generally harmless, and you may have been exposed to them for most of your life without any issues. However, when the number of spores increases, they can reduce air quality and cause allergic reactions. Symptoms of mold exposure may include irritated eyes, mouth, and throat, difficulty breathing, and other respiratory issues.

Mold can quickly become a problem if it begins to form colonies. These colonies can develop within just 24 hours if the conditions are right. They can cause ongoing damage to your property and can continue to grow and spread if not dealt with. Mold colonies can reduce air quality by releasing spores as they consume organic materials. In addition to deteriorating organic materials, they can also continue to grow and spread. It's important to address mold colonies as soon as they are discovered in order to prevent further damage to your property.

Here are some organic materials you could spot mold on:

  • Drywall
  • Wood
  • Carpet
  • Leather
  • Cotton
  • Paper products
  • Ceiling tiles
  • Insulation
  • In order to grow and thrive, mold needs moisture, humidity, and organic material.     Step 2: Inspection & Assessment of Property

    Our team will schedule a convenient time for you and your property, and then conduct an inspection to assess the situation.

    Mold Containment icon

    Mold Containment icon
    Step 3: Mold Containment

    To prevent the mold from spreading, we will implement containment measures and protocols for affected areas.

    Filtering The Air icon

    Filtering The Air icon
    Step 4: Filtering The Air

    We will use HEPA filters and vacuums to remove mold spores from the air in affected areas.

    Removing Mold and Affected Materials icon

    Removing Mold and Affected Materials icon
    Step 5: Removing Mold and Affected Materials

    We will dispose of any affected building materials, such as drywall, insulation, carpeting, or wallpaper.

    Property Restoration icon

    Property Restoration icon
    Step 6: Property Restoration

    Finally, we will restore your property to its pre-loss conditions, clean affected areas, and protect your property against future mold outbreaks. We will also administer antimicrobial treatments to help prevent future mold growth.
